Henning Fentzelau. The Bantu peoples and their languages are spread across vast areas of Western, Central and Southern Africa. On his new album, Hymns of Bantu, the South African cellist, singer and composer Abel Salauchwe pays tribute to both his Bantu roots and the Western classical music he studied. The album brings together sounds as diverse as throat singing and bark.
